Suggested track layouts

Now comes the fun part—deciding what kind of layout you want. The only rule is that
you let your imagination be your guide. Figure 1 shows some examples of layouts you can
build with eight straight and eight curved sections of track. Remember—the more track you
own, the more variations you can create in your train layout. That means more action and
more fun!
Figure 1. Track layout suggestions
We recommend that you do not set-up your track layout on carpeted surfaces.
Note!
Carpet fibers may collect on your engine's wheels and drive gears, and prevent your
engine from operating properly. For best results, place track on a hard surface.
